The last several times I checked Windows Update, I find the same 2 updates that were there before. They always are shown to be successful update installations, but they are always listed as available updates the next time I check. The one that concerns me the most is a critical update. “Cumulative Security Update for Outlook Express 6, Service Pack 1” (KB837009). The other is a driver update for the onboard sound from the motherboard manufacturer. I use Trend-Micro PC-cillin and the OE6 SP1update is also listed as a Microsoft security vulnerability problem, so I assume it is not really installed. If I check installed updates they are listed multiple times. I would appreciate any help someone can offer. Thanks in advance.

You assume correctly, they are NOT installed. Find and remove them from Add/Remove Programs, delete your Temporary Internet Files from Internet Options and try WinUp site again where they will likely 'take' for real this time.

OR you can try to apply the off-line versions found at the Catalog site. Best results happen when off-line.
http://v4.windowsupdate.microsoft.com/catalog/

Drivers from WinUP? I've never heard anything good about doing that, best to get them from the manufacturer's site instead?

Thanks for the suggestions. When I tried to remove it in Add/Remove Program, it gave an error message that said it could not properly remove it. I emptied the IE temp folder and this time it took longer to download the update, so I was hopeful. It still did not work, so I read the info sheet with the update and it lead me to a file download. I could not install it because it says I need OE SP1 which I thought I already have. I may try reinstalling IE6/OE6 SP1 and try again or use the catalog site you mentioned. Thanks again!
